Pet's info: Dog | Mixed Breed Medium (23 - 60lb) | Female | spayed | 9 months and 5 days old | 38 lbs
Why does my dog sometimes look sad for no reason?Is she in pain?She doesn't whine, she just sits there and her ears are back.Then after a while she gets happy to see me and gives me her paw.

Hello and thanks for using Petco Pet Education Center, formerly Petcoach! Dogs can act sad or depressed For many reasons (including fear, stress, pain or illness). Without having an examination it's hard to determine why Darby may be acting this way. Because Darby is younger I feel it's important to have her checked out by a veterinarian within the next few weeks to see if there is a medical issue. You may also want to record the behavior to show to your veterinarian during the appointment.
